  "summary": "NEW YORK (AP) — Elon Musk's social media company X, formerly known as Twitter, launched its own bank account-like product where users can send money to one another. The service, known as X Money, is not a new bank. X Money is using technology and banking services provided by Cross River Bank, and branding that...",
